The most common shape today is hexagonal, six sides give a good granularity of angles for a tool to approach from (good in tight spots), but more (and smaller) corners would be vulnerable to being rounded off.
It takes only one sixth of a rotation to obtain the next side of the hexagon and grip is optimal.
However, polygons with more than six sides do not give the requisite grip and polygons with fewer than six sides take more time to be given a complete rotation.
Galvanised is a Hot-dip or Spelter galvanised finish approximately 60 microns thick.
The product is dipped in molten zinc, resulting in a thick, rough coating that has a high corrision resistance.
